// on each invokation.
Class[] argsClasses = {Session.class, Event.class};
visitorMethods.put("visitMulticast", this.getClass().getMethod("visitMulticast", argsClasses));
visitorMethods.put("visitBroadcast", this.getClass().getMethod("visitBroadcast", argsClasses));
} catch (NoSuchMethodException e) {
throw new PushletException("Failed to setup SessionManagerVisitor", e);
}
}